2015年6月16日
摘要: 在前几篇中有简单介绍服务端的认证方式,默认的是直接在deployerConfigContext.xml文件中一个叫做primaryAuthenticationHandler的bean中配置。不过这只支持一个账号,而且是固定的,这有非常大的局限性,在现实系统中是肯定不能用这样的方式的。现在的应用系统一... 阅读全文
posted @ 2015-06-16 10:20 路东头的夕阳。 阅读(342) 评论(0) 推荐(0) 编辑
摘要: 1.概念相关①.术语解释TGT、ST、PGT、PGTIOU、PT,其中CAS1.0协议中就有的票据,PGT、PGTIOU、PT是CAS2.0协议中有的票据。CAS为用户签发的登录票据,拥有了CAS成功登录过。CAS认证成功后,TGT对象,放入自己的缓存,CAS生成的cookie,则TGT,如果有的话... 阅读全文
posted @ 2015-06-16 10:18 路东头的夕阳。 阅读(3467) 评论(0) 推荐(1) 编辑
摘要: 1.CAS 基本流程图(没有使用PROXY代理)2. 使用代理的 CAS 流程图PS:proxy模式比基本模板相对更复杂,LZ也没有了解的非常清楚,下面的图流程LZ也有一些不清楚的地方,大家可以相互交流。总结本文章全部转自http://www.cnblogs.com/vhua/tag/cas/ 阅读全文
posted @ 2015-06-16 10:16 路东头的夕阳。 阅读(342) 评论(0) 推荐(0) 编辑
摘要: 接着上一篇,在上一篇中我们描述了怎么在CAS SERVER登录页上添加验证码,并进行登录。一旦CAS SERVER验证成功后,我们就会跳转到客户端中去。跳转到客户端去后,大家想一想,客户端总要获取用户信息吧,不然客户端是怎么知道登录的是哪个用户。那么客户端要怎么获取用户信息呢?其实验证成功,跳转客户... 阅读全文
posted @ 2015-06-16 10:13 路东头的夕阳。 阅读(401) 评论(0) 推荐(0) 编辑
摘要: 附上源代码:http://pan.baidu.com/s/1mgDptZa 这一篇主要是讲解怎么在登录页上添加验证码功能,默认的登录页是只有用户名与密码功能。其他我觉得加验证码没什么用,因为现在我部门做的系统主要是放在内网里,外网是不能访问的。登录页的验证码主要是为了防止进账号进行暴力破解,不过我... 阅读全文
posted @ 2015-06-16 10:12 路东头的夕阳。 阅读(1150) 评论(0) 推荐(0) 编辑
摘要: 一.开始 下图是CAS默认的登录界面,可以看到这界面是肯定不能直接用在生产环境上的,因为上面的有许多英文,简单来说,这是一个对客户非常不友好的界面。那么怎么修改它呢?我们接着往下看! ps:这个页面在工程中的地址为cas\WEB-INF\view\jsp\default\ui\casLogi... 阅读全文
posted @ 2015-06-16 10:10 路东头的夕阳。 阅读(365) 评论(0) 推荐(0) 编辑
摘要: 一、概述 今天开始写CAS相关的第一篇文章,这篇文章主要是关于CAS环境的搭配,提供给刚刚接触CAS的一个入门指南,并演示一个CAS的最简单的实例二、环境要求博主的环境如下:win8.1 64 bitJDK1.7下载地址点我Tomcat-8.0.15下载地址点我cas-server-4.0.0 、... 阅读全文
posted @ 2015-06-16 10:08 路东头的夕阳。 阅读(253) 评论(0) 推荐(0) 编辑